Description
The fruit for this wine was grown on the lower terraces of Askerne Vineyard.
The fruit was handpicked then whole bunch pressed. After settling it was racked to barrel. 100% of the juice was barrel fermented. 20 % new French oak with the balance one to three years old. A mixture of wild and inoculated ferments. A considerable proportion of the barrels went through malolactic fermentation. It was in barrel for 9 months.
